DIY: Knit Mountain Mist Pullover by Tin Can Knits
The Mountain Mist pullover is a beautiful yoked sweater pattern by Tin Can Knits. It is from Tin Can Knits’ Strange Brew pattern book, which I purchased last year. The pattern uses worsted weight yarn and includes 25 sizes, from baby to big. Imagine knitting matching parent-and-baby sweaters! I knit size SM, starting on December […]

DIY: Knit Diamond Hat and Free Pattern by Anne Mizoguchi
The Diamond Hat is a free pattern by Anne Mizoguchi, one of a series of colourwork hats. I used three colours of Rooster Almerino DK, a soft alpaca-merino blend yarn.
